I saw Dr. Sharfae about 2 years ago and she told me then I had some cavities. I left her practice because I had just seen my old dentist a few months earlier and he had told me everything was fine. After Dr. Sharfae, I went to another dentist who again told me everything was fine. About 2 months ago I had a couple of sensitive teeth. My dentist now tells me I need 2 root canals. These are the same two teeth as far as I remember that Dr. Sharfae had told me needed fillings just 2 years ago and I didn?t believe it. I got a second opinion today and again was told I needed two root canals because of cavities that had made it to the nerve. I just wanted to post this for two reasons. First to say I?m sorry to Dr. Sharfae for not believing her. Secondly, how is one to know when it comes to dentists. I saw one before and one after Dr. Sharfae who apparently didn?t see a cavity, and now I have to have root canals and crowns?
